diff scripts/image/imshow.m @ 18884:b1f092e1a887

imshow.m: Ignore hold state and set axis variables for image display for Matlab compatibility. * imshow.m: Ignore hold state and set the following axis variables: visible=off, view=[0,90], ydir=reverse, layer=top, clim=display_range.
author Rik <rik@octave.org>
date Fri, 02 May 2014 10:02:24 -0700
parents c79696701468
children 0461fe1d2a01
line wrap: on
line diff
--- a/scripts/image/imshow.m
+++ b/scripts/image/imshow.m
@@ -206,8 +206,9 @@
     htmp = image (xdata, ydata, im);
   else
     htmp = imagesc (xdata, ydata, im, display_range);
+    set (gca (), "clim", display_range);
   endif
-  set (gca (), "visible", "off");
+  set (gca (), "visible", "off", "view", [0, 90], "ydir", "reverse", "layer", "top");
   axis ("image");
 
   if (nargout > 0)